How do manufacturers test the UV resistance of materials used in landscape round trash cans?
Manufacturers employ rigorous testing methods to evaluate the UV resistance of materials used in landscape round trash cans, ensuring longevity and color retention in outdoor environments. One common approach is accelerated weathering testing, where materials are exposed to intense UV light, moisture, and heat cycles in specialized chambers like QUV or Xenon-arc testers. These simulations replicate years of sun exposure in just weeks or months.
Another method involves real-world outdoor exposure testing, where material samples are placed in high-solar-radiation locations for extended periods. Manufacturers often follow ASTM standards such as ASTM G154 (for fluorescent UV exposure) or ASTM D4329 (for plastic weathering) to maintain consistency.
Additionally, spectrophotometers measure color changes and gloss retention, while mechanical tests assess whether UV degradation has weakened the material's structural integrity. High-performance materials like HDPE or UV-stabilized polymers typically undergo these tests to prove their suitability for long-term outdoor use in products like landscape trash cans.
